Ticket: Kiosk watchdog restarting every 30s on the Dunmore lobby units. Root cause: the Perchline watchdog env file was copied from staging, so it points at the wrong heartbeat endpoint and lacks the reporting credential. Fix carefully — editing the live env file while the watchdog runs can wedge the kiosk. Stop the service, correct the endpoint, then append the following line:

sealed setting: VAULT_KEY3=eec

Leadership Review Briefing — Warranty Costs

Quick heads-up before Thursday: warranty spend on the Torvell G2 pump line is running about 40% over plan. Root cause looks like the seal supplier switch we made in spring — returns from the Drellmont region spiked first. Marta's team has a containment fix in testing, but we'll likely eat two more months of elevated claims. Budget reforecast attached. One more thing worth flagging before we circulate wider:

board note of kageg-bahof: The renewal with Holwynax Holdings closes at $2 million a year, 5 percent below the last contract. Project Ulaath slips by two quarters because of the supplier delay.

## Runbook: Spincount turnstile counter

Spincount aggregates gate spins at Bellmoor Stadium and publishes totals every 30 seconds. Before any release: freeze deploys from two hours pre-gates-open until final whistle. Verify the replay rig matches production counts within 0.5% before promoting a build. If counts stall, restart the collector first, aggregator second — never both at once or you lose the in-flight window. Rollback is a config-only operation. Production currently runs with the following values.

service settings:
PRAIX_LOG_LEVEL=error
PRAIX_METRICS_HOST=metrics.praix.qorvelcorp.corp
PRAIX_POOL_SIZE=16